IDNLearn.com provides a user-friendly platform for finding and sharing accurate answers. Ask anything and receive prompt, well-informed answers from our community of experienced experts.

Select the word from the list which most closely matches the literal definition (given in quotes). 'the act of offering or carrying something to God'
A. disoblige
B. ablation
C. oblation
D. obdurate